Doju 〜 a combination of Head Chef/Owner Mika Chae’s hometown Jeollanam-do and Meju, a fermented, Korean soybean block. Meju is the first step for making a number of Korean dishes like doenjang (Korean miso), ganjang (soy sauce) and gochujang (chilli paste). Since Doju is Mika’s first restaurant, Meju is perfectly incorporated into the name and sets the scene for meaningful, passionate food.

Paying tribute to its lively past, Alexander Bar is named after the original owner of the hotel first built on the site in the 1880s. This was reincarnated in 1926 as The Hotel Alexander. Alexander Bar is now the elegant ground floor attraction at The Savoy Hotel Little Collins, infused with a rich history. Famous guests could once be found here during the jazz era and beyond, sipping on cocktails while listening to the easy sounds of crooners sharing the scene. The space has recently been refurbished in a contemporary Art Deco design, honouring its origins. The bar, encased in marble, showcases bold geometric patterned carpets, linear angled pillars, full-length mirrors, and classic tray ceilings, complemented by soft lighting.
